### Account Recovery — Catalogue Import (Lintwood)

Quick one for review: when the Lintwood catalogue import wipes a patron's session table, the recovery flow re-seeds accounts from the nightly snapshot. Check that the importer skips locked accounts — last time it didn't. To rerun recovery against staging you'll need the vault passphrase, which is appended just below.

recovery phrase for yafof-tajof: julmir-kelax-julvan-holath-belvan-holir-ralael-ralvan-ralath-julvan-silmir-istmir-kaswyn-ulamir

Ticket: Staging env misconfigured for Siftgate bloom filter

The bloom layer in front of the Pellet KV store is rejecting all lookups in staging because the env file was copied from the dev template without credentials. False-positive tuning values are fine; only the auth line is missing. To unblock the weekly demo, the Pellet admission secret must be set on the following line.

env line for yaguf-fajop: LEDGER_TOKEN13=fb08984397349

CI note — Parcelhaven stale-cache postmortem

If the artifact cache serves modules older than the lockfile, the restore key is colliding again. Purge the branch-scoped cache and rerun with cache disabled to confirm. Full remediation is tracked in the postmortem doc. The affected pipeline run is identified by the trace token below.

pipeline stamp: htk31_f769b577b3028a4e9958e5bb8d1259a

Welcome to the Pellgrove on-call rotation. Before your first shift, please review how we load test the Quillcart checkout flow: tests run nightly against the Fernside staging environment, and failures page the secondary first. Thresholds, abort procedures, and historical results are documented carefully. You can find the full playbook on our internal wiki page.

wiki page, fahaf-yagag: https://confluence.qorvellabs.internal/pages/display/pages/display